CVE-2020-3994
CVE-2020-3994 affects VMware vCenter Server (versions 6.7 before 6.7u3, 6.6 before 6.5u3k). It is a session hijack vulnerability in the vCenter Server Appliance Management Interface (VAMI) update function caused by a lack of certificate validation. CVE-2020-3976
CVE-2020-3976 affects VMware ESXi and vCenter Server, describing a partial denial-of-service in their authentication services.
